About the Role

As a CT Technologist, you will perform advanced imaging procedures including ultrasound, CT, PET, interventional radiology, digital mammography, and nuclear medicine.

Responsibilities

  • Collaborate with a multidisciplinary team to deliver high-quality imaging services.
  • Perform clinical imaging duties across multiple modalities (CT, ultrasound, PET, interventional radiology, digital mammography, and nuclear medicine).
  • Assist radiologists during interventional procedures.
  • Communicate effectively with patients, colleagues, and other healthcare providers.
  • Build and maintain strong professional relationships.
  • Ensure excellence in patient care and safety.
  • Pursue continuous professional growth and development.
  • Focus on improving patient experience and operational efficiency.

Requirements

  • Graduate of an approved Radiologic Technologist Program.
  • Current BLS (Basic Life Support) certification.
  • Active ARRT (American Registry of Radiologic Technologists) certification.
  • Texas Department of State Health Services certification.
  • Preferred: 1 year of relevant experience.
